This article describes historical game content.
The prophecy system was removed from the game in version 3.17.0. Itemised prophecies no longer exist in Path of Exile.
Not in game
Seal cost: 2× Silver CoinMetadata
Item class: Currency Item
Monstrous Treasure is a prophecy.
Objective
Go to a map area. The area contain 36 strongboxes where all non fixed-placed monsters are packed into.
Note: This prophecy stacks with Zana's ambush mod.
Notes
- Area contains 36 strongboxes.
- Only available in map.
- All non fixed-placed monsters are packed into a strongbox.

Version history
Despite the prophecy mechanic is removed from the game in version 3.17.0, the Monstrous Treasure was reworked as a special map crafting option in the same patch. It was granted from the atlas passive Shaping the Skies.
